American Express is turning heads among investors as it fuels a remarkable journey in dividend investing—a strategy championed by none other than the legendary investor whose long-term approach continues to inspire millions. With steady gains and resilient growth, American Express stands out as a prime example of value investing at its finest.

Buffett’s philosophy centers on acquiring robust, well-managed companies and holding them to benefit from the magic of compounding returns. Over decades, this approach has generated stellar results, with dividend stocks playing a critical role in the overall market’s explosive growth. In recent years, American Express has delivered a 100-fold return since its inception in Buffett’s portfolio, boasting a 21% compound annual growth rate over the past five years.

The firm’s recent surge of over 46% in just 12 months reflects its strength. In the final quarter of 2024, revenues soared beyond $17 billion with net income climbing by 12% year-over-year. American Express continues to impress by expanding its global network, securing record highs in card member spending, and significantly growing its merchant base—all while steadily increasing its quarterly dividend, now at $0.82 per share.
